Performance Specifications
Operating Temperature Range: Model dependent; see table below
Temperature Stability: ±0.04C (±0.08°F)
Pump Type: 2-speed pressure
60Hz models
50Hz models
Maximum Pressure: 3.5 psi (0.24 bar) 2.9 psi (0.20 bar)
Maximum Pressure Flow Rate: 2.9 gpm (11.0 lpm) 2.7 gpm (10.2 lpm)
Heater Wattage: 1100 watts 2200 watts

Environmental Conditions Indoor use only
Maximum Altitude: 2000 meter
Operating Ambient: 5° to 35°C (41° to 95°F)
Relative Humidity: 80%, non-condensing
Installation Category: II
Pollution Degree: 2
Ingress Protection: IP 31
Climate Class: SN
Software Class: B
Output Waveform: Sinusoidal
